Pros & Cons
Pros
These are perfect. I use them both for hair styling and as shawl/sweater pins for my hand-knits and crocheted items. I believe they will work well even with finer hair.
Easy to use and it doesn't get tangled up in my hair. I take them out (this takes slightly longer since you have to relocate them all in your hair haha, but still isn't a deterrent at all for me) and my hair isn't at all tangled.
Putting my hair into a bun was always an ordeal. These spiral pins are the bomb for holding it all in a nice bun. I use three or four and the bun feels secure and neat.
Cons
After many months of use (i'm a nurse i use them daily) the tynes become splayed and removing them becomes difficult.
Even with using just two of these pins my arms get tired while styling. This makes it to where the pins do not spin in or out smoothly. Just save your money, either buy the really good grippy ones or just get a standard bobby-pin.
